A fire at a mosque early this morning is under investigation.
The fire broke out at the Avondale Islamic Centre in Blockhouse Bay, West Auckland.
The Fire Service was alerted to the blaze at 2:41am, said Megan Ruru, northern fire communications shift manager.
Six appliances were sent to the fire.
"A small fire was located in a storage area attached to the side of the main building," Detective Senior Sergeant Paul Newman from Glenn Innes CIB said.
"Damage was limited to the inside of this shed. The Mosque itself was not damaged."
He added: "Thankfully, a member of the public noticed smoke and call for assistance."
The cause of the fire is now being investigated by the Fire Service and police, Mr Newman said.
